Opaque ruby and packed with dark bramble fruits, Morello cherries, licorice and black pepper, this is a full bodied, fresh, moderately tannic Zinfandel. The wine's alcohol (listed as 14.8%) is nicely integrated and the oak serves in a complementary, non-dominant role. Rich and dense on the mid-palate, it moves on to a lengthy finish. This structured Zin is beautifully balanced and should be at its best over the next 3-4 years. Drink now-2021.

Deep dark purple garnet in color; almost opaque. Full, forward, & attractive nose of ripe fruit aromas of dark cherries, blackberries & plums with overtones of briary & earthy notes, spices, dried herbs, dark cocoa, minerals & a hint of cedar in the background. Full bodied with a very good concentration of well balanced, & smooth textured, lush, rich, ripe fruit flavors of dark cherries, blackberries and blueberries with spices, herbs, minerals & dark cocoa. Long lingering finish. Drinks quite well at present with decanting and airing but has the fruit and structure to continue development with much needed aging. An excellent Zin!
